In bronze gilt, measuring 33. 3 mm in diameter, original ribbon with brooch pinback, extremely fine. Footnote: The National Society of the Sons of the American Revolution (SAR or NSSAR) is a congressionally chartered organization, founded in 1889, and headquartered in Louisville, Kentucky.
